Core Market Segments and Analysis

The cell reprogramming market consists primarily of three core segments: technology type, application, and end user. Regarding technology, induced pluripotent stem cells (iPSCs) dominate both revenue and growth, owing to their versatility in disease modeling and therapeutic applications. iPSCs market trends show growth exceeding 10% CAGR, bolstered by clinical trial successes in 2024. Among applications, regenerative medicine remains the dominant segment, benefiting from advanced cell therapy products that gained regulatory approvals in 2024. Conversely, drug discovery is the fastest-growing sub-segment, with increasing adoption in pharmaceutical pipelines to expedite target validation and toxicity testing. End user segments include academic and research institutes, biopharmaceutical companies, and contract research organizations, with biopharmaceuticals showing the fastest growth due to higher R&D expenditure.

Segment Analysis: Technology Type

Focusing on the technology-type segment, induced pluripotent stem cells (iPSCs) remain the market’s dominant sub-segment in terms of market revenue, driven by their broad therapeutic potential and ethical advantages over embryonic stem cells. Commercial revenue from iPSCs-based products and services accounted for over 60% of the total technology revenue in 2024. The fastest-growing sub-segment is direct lineage reprogramming, exhibiting impressive growth due to clinical developments in neurological disorder treatments.
